>  기사  >  CMS 튜토리얼  >  WordPress 게시물 발췌를 설정하는 방법

WordPress 게시물 발췌를 설정하는 방법

爱喝马黛茶的安东尼
爱喝马黛茶的安东尼원래의
2019-07-19 16:04:403385검색

WordPress 게시물 발췌를 설정하는 방법

WordPress에서 기사 요약을 표시하는 네 가지 방법은 다음과 같습니다.

1. WordPress에 내장된 요약 기능을 사용합니다.

현재 다른 WordPress 블로그에서 이 방법을 사용하고 있으며 표시 효과도 매우 만족스럽습니다. 유일한 단점은 기사를 작성할 때 별도의 초록을 설정해야 한다는 것입니다. 그러나 이 점은 다소 번거롭기는 하지만 유연성이 좋다는 점을 변증법적으로 보아야 한다.

사용 설정 방법:

1. 기사 편집 페이지 오른쪽 상단의 '옵션 표시'를 클릭하고, 그 안에 있는 '요약' 옵션을 체크한 후, 기사 작성 시 요약 내용을 별도로 작성합니다.

2. 기사가 게시된 후에도 홈페이지에는 전문이 출력되는 반면, 카테고리, 태그 등 아카이브 페이지에는 요약이 표시되는 것을 볼 수 있습니다. 다음 방법을 사용하여 문제를 해결할 수 있습니다.

3. WordPress 백엔드 "Appearance" - "Edit"에서 loop.php 파일을 클릭하여 수정합니다. 137번째 줄에 대해 다음 문장을 찾아서 수정하고 홈페이지 해당 판단을 추가합니다. 빨간색 글꼴이 추가된 부분입니다. .

<?php if ( is_archive() || is_search() || is_home() ) : // Only display excerpts for archives and search. ?>

4. 설정이 완료되면 다른 아카이브 페이지와 마찬가지로 홈페이지가 요약되어 표시됩니다.

관련 추천: "WordPress Tutorial"

2. "more" 분리 태그를 삽입하세요

1. 이것도 WordPress 고유의 요약 설정 방법 중 하나입니다. 나중에 "more" 분리 태그를 삽입하거나, 위 편집기에서 "more" 분리 아이콘을 클릭하거나, "fc430c7db1eecf4621f4fc8a5479f894" 라벨 문을 직접 작성할 수 있습니다.

2. 설정 후 홈페이지 및 기타 아카이브 페이지가 요약처럼 표시되며, 요약 뒤에 "계속 읽기 →" 링크가 자동으로 추가됩니다. 하지만 이 링크를 자세히 살펴보면 그 뒤에 #more-id가 추가된 것을 볼 수 있습니다. 클릭하면 계속 읽을 수 있는 요약 콘텐츠로 이동합니다.

3. 이 앵커 포인트 점프를 제거할지 여부는 개인 취향에 따라 다릅니다. 제거하려면 WordPress 백엔드 "모양" - "편집"에서 function.php 파일을 클릭하여 수정하고 다음 코드를 복사하여 추가하세요. 코드의 의미는 워드프레스 the_content_more_link의 필터를 이용하고, 정규식을 추가하여 링크에 있는 #more-id 형태의 문자열을 아무것도 없는 것으로 대체한다는 것입니다.

코드는 다음과 같습니다.

function remove_more_jump_link($link) {
return preg_replace(&#39;/#more-\d+/i&#39;,&#39;&#39;,$link);
}
add_filter(&#39;the_content_more_link&#39;, &#39;remove_more_jump_link&#39;);

3. 테마 index.php 파일을 수정합니다

1. 테마를 사용하고 있는 폴더를 열고 index.php 파일을 찾아 다음 코드를 찾습니다.

<?php the_content(__(’(more…)’)); ?>或者<?php the_content(); ?>

2. 다음과 같이 수정합니다:

코드는 다음과 같습니다.

<?php if(!is_single()) {
the_excerpt();
} else {
the_content(__(’(more…)’));//或者<?php the_content(); ?>
} ?>

3. 저장 후 기사가 자동으로 초록을 가로챌 수 있습니다. 그러나 단점은 굵은 글씨, 글꼴 등 초록의 형식이 사라진다는 것입니다. 색상 등

4. 요약 플러그인을 사용하세요

워드프레스에는 우리의 사용에 적합하지 않은 부분이 있지만 다행히도 많은 플러그인이 있고, 기사 요약을 자동으로 설정하는 플러그인도 많습니다. 사용하기 쉬운 몇 가지.

1. WP-UTF8-Excerpt: 멀티바이트 언어(예: 중국어)를 지원하고 잘못된 문자를 생성하지 않으며 형식을 유지합니다.

2. WP-Posts 자동 절단기: UTF-8 방법을 사용하여 중국어 문자가 깨지지 않고 요약 형식을 유지합니다. 이 플러그인의 작성자는 WordPress에 제출하지 않았습니다. 작성자의 홈페이지(http://blog.netdll.com/?p=1276)에서만 다운로드할 수 있습니다(웹사이트가 차단되었습니다).

3. 게시물 자동 제한: 주로 영어 사이트에서 사용되며, 중국어로 사용하면 오류가 발생합니다

위 내용은 WordPress 게시물 발췌를 설정하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.